Critical Behavior for 2d Uniform and Disordered Ferromagnets at Self-Dual Points

Abstract

We consider certain two-dimensional systems with self--dual points including uniform and disordered q-state Potts models. For systems with continuous energy density (such as the disordered versions) it is established that the self--dual point exhibits critical behavior: Infinite susceptibility, vanishing magnetization and power law bounds for the decay of correlations.
